mazhe 项目教程
mazhe(almost) Everything I know in math.项目地址:https://gitcode.com/gh_mirrors/ma/mazhe
1. 项目的目录结构及介绍
mazhe/
├── LICENSE
├── README.md
├── src/
│ ├── main.py
│ ├── config.py
│ └── utils/
│ ├── helper.py
│ └── logger.py
└── tests/
├── test_main.py
└── test_utils.py
- LICENSE: 项目的许可证文件。
- README.md: 项目的介绍和使用说明。
- src/: 项目的源代码目录。
- main.py: 项目的启动文件。
- config.py: 项目的配置文件。
- utils/: 包含项目中使用的工具函数。
- helper.py: 辅助函数。
- logger.py: 日志记录工具。
- tests/: 项目的测试代码目录。
- test_main.py: 针对
main.py
的测试文件。 - test_utils.py: 针对
utils/
目录下的工具函数的测试文件。
- test_main.py: 针对
2. 项目的启动文件介绍
src/main.py
是项目的启动文件,负责初始化项目并启动主要功能。该文件通常包含以下内容:
- 导入依赖: 导入项目所需的模块和库。
- 配置加载: 从
config.py
中加载项目的配置。 - 主函数: 定义项目的主要逻辑和功能。
- 启动代码: 调用主函数并启动项目。
3. 项目的配置文件介绍
src/config.py
是项目的配置文件,用于存储项目的各种配置参数。该文件通常包含以下内容:
- 数据库配置: 数据库连接信息、用户名、密码等。
- 日志配置: 日志级别、日志文件路径等。
- 其他配置: 项目中其他需要配置的参数,如 API 密钥、超时时间等。
配置文件通常以字典或类的形式存储配置项,方便在项目中进行读取和使用。
mazhe(almost) Everything I know in math.项目地址:https://gitcode.com/gh_mirrors/ma/mazhe
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考